We have been using the Bq24072RGTR in our project as a charger for charging 4.2V Li-ion battery. We are using a 5V as input supply which will pass through a Schottky diode before entering the IC, so the voltage that enters the IC will be around 4.35 - 4.5 V.
We have connected the PGOOD pin to our Interrupt pin of MC and During the full charge of the battery we are facing a strange behavior at PGOOD pin, like it its toggling between HIGH/LOW and getting the interrupt. While checking the datasheet of the BQ24072, we found a condition for the PGOOD pin status indicator in the below image. Based on the below condition, it seems when the battery reaches 4.2 V which adds with Vin(DT) is 130 mv which will be 4.33V. If the Vin is less than the Vbat+Vin(Dt), PGOOD is LOW.
So we planned to disable the CE pin at a certain level of the battery and stops it reaching the full battery to stop this toggling of PGOOD pin. This cycle of disabling the CE pin will be keep on repeating during every charging, will these kind of disabling CE will cause any problem in future?
